环境和生物因素对日本黑牛犊STT I及正常总泪液蛋白浓度的影响。

The effect of environmental and biological factors on STT I and normal total tear protein concentration in Japanese black calves.

Abstract

To identify reference values for the Schirmer tear test I (STT I) in Japanese black cattle, investigate the effects of variables (sex, age, time of day, and environment in the barn including environmental temperature, humidity, illuminance, and ammonia concentration) on tear production, and determine total tear protein concentration. One-hundred-and-thirty-seven Japanese black cattle (67 females and 70 males, age 3-90 days) were evaluated. The mean STT I values was 18.9 ± 2.9 mm/min (n=263) and significant effects were age and ammonia concentration in the barn. Mean total tear protein concentration was 1.18 ± 0.30 mg/ml in healthy cattle older than 15 days (n=38). It was suggested that age and ammonia concentration are related to fluctuation of tear volume.

摘要

为确定日本黑牛Schirmer I 试验(STT I)的参考值,研究变量(性别、年龄、一天中的时间以及牛舍环境,包括环境温度、湿度、光照度和氨浓度)对泪液分泌的影响,并测定泪液总蛋白浓度。对137头日本黑牛(67头雌性和70头雄性,年龄3 - 90天)进行了评估。STT I的平均值为18.9±2.9毫米/分钟(n = 263),年龄和牛舍中的氨浓度有显著影响。15日龄以上健康牛的泪液总蛋白平均浓度为1.18±0.30毫克/毫升(n = 38)。结果表明,年龄和氨浓度与泪液量的波动有关。
